Bathing Your Dolls Hair and Body
Go to your bathroom or kitchen sink. This is where you will give your Barbie a bath.
Get a small paper cup and cotton swab.
Put a small amount of shampoo in the paper cup and fill it with water. If you want, you can fill it with hand soap and water but shampoo smells better and will give your Barbie a more realistic bath.
Dip a cotton ball in the shampoo and rub it all over your dolls hair. Make sure you cover all of her hair.
Rub the shampoo into the dolls hair until you see suds, just like you do for yourself.
Rinse your dolls hair under the tap until all the shampoo is gone.
Rinse your paper cup.
Put a small amount of body soap in the paper cup and fill it with water. If you want you can fill it with hand soap and water.
Dip a cotton ball in the body soap and rub it on your doll's body, making sure you get all the dirt off and clean her very well.
Rinse her thoroughly.
Dry her hair and body.
Brush her hair softly, getting all the knots out, so it's nice and smooth. Make sure you brush it gently to avoid pulling out a lot of hair. Don't be afraid if some hair falls out.
Hair Makeover
Wait until your dolls hair is dry.
Colour her hair in with a washable marker. This will only last for a day or two. You can rinse it off later with soap and hot water. To colour it permanently, use a permanent marker. Make sure you want to do it though because it won't come off once you've done it.
If you want to cut her hair, make sure you want to do it because she won't grow it back! Decide on the hairstyle for your doll and carefully use craft scissors to cut it.
Style her hair with hair spray. Don't use a curling iron or straightener on her hair because it will burn her hair.
Make her hair sparkle. To add some glitter to her hair, mix some glitter with hair gel in your paper cup and use a cotton ball to put it on her hair. It will make her hair pretty and glittery and you can wash it off later with soap and water.
Change her hairstyle. Try doing buns, ponytails (or you could even try doing an inverted ponytail, though you have to be careful as her hair will tangle easily), pigtails, braids or any other style you like. To be creative, make your own hairstyle!
Face and Body Makeover
Change her lip colour and makeup. Use washable or permanent markers. Washable markers will come off with soap and water but permanent markers won't come off!
Use a washable marker to give her a removable tattoo. It will wash off with soap and water. If you want to give your doll a permanent tattoo, use a permanent marker but make sure you want to do this because it won't come off! Always test the permanent marker first. Some permanent markers are too thick for tattoos or are a bit dry.
Give your doll a new fashion style. Make some new clothes for her using fabric and old or small clothes.
